General Motors unveiled the new EV version of the automaker’s most famous luxury model on Wednesday. It’s part of GM’s plans to sell nothing but zero-emission passenger vehicles by 2035. To accomplish that goal, GM must find ways to appeal to those customers for whom emissions are not the highest priority. So the new Escalade IQ has flashy light displays and electric motors able to produce a total of 750 horsepower. That’s 10% more than even the most powerful gasoline-powered Escalade model.

GM has not yet shared the weight of the Escalade IQ, but the Chevrolet Silverado EV, with a similarly sized battery pack, weighs about 8,500 pounds. That’s roughly 1 ton more than the supercharged Cadillac Escalade V.

2025 Cadillac Escalade IQ: 750 hp, 450-mile range, screens galoreThe all-electric Cadillac Escalade IQ offers impressive power, a range of 450 miles, advanced technology, and a starting price of $130,000. With dual motors delivering up to 750 hp and 785 lb-ft of torque, this SUV provides all-wheel drive and can reach 60 mph in under five seconds. In Velocity Max mode, it achieves its top power and performance figures, while Normal mode offers 680 hp and 615 lb-ft of torque.
